First and foremost, an incinerator system offers a more sustainable method of waste disposal compared to traditional landfill practices. Landfills take up valuable land space and can lead to various environmental issues such as groundwater contamination and methane gas emissions. In contrast, incineration reduces the volume of waste by up to 90%, minimizing the need for landfills and alleviating the strain on our planet’s resources.
Another key advantage of utilizing an incinerator system is the ability to generate energy from waste. Modern incinerators are equipped with advanced technology that allows them to convert the heat produced during the incineration process into electricity. This sustainable energy source can then be used to power homes, businesses, and even the incinerator itself, making the process more self-sufficient and cost-effective in the long run.
Furthermore, incinerator systems offer a more efficient and controlled method of waste disposal compared to other options. Incinerators can reach high temperatures of up to 1,800 degrees Fahrenheit, ensuring complete combustion of waste materials and minimizing the release of harmful pollutants into the atmosphere. Advanced air pollution control systems can also be installed to further reduce emissions, making incineration a cleaner and safer alternative to burning waste in open pits or landfills.
In addition to its environmental benefits, an incinerator system can also provide economic advantages for municipalities and waste management facilities. By reducing the volume of waste that needs to be transported and disposed of in landfills, incineration can help lower the overall costs associated with waste management. Furthermore, the energy generated from incineration can be sold back to the grid, providing an additional revenue stream for facilities that invest in this technology.
One of the key benefits of an incinerator system is its versatility in handling various types of waste materials. From municipal solid waste to hazardous materials, incinerators are designed to accommodate a wide range of waste streams and ensure safe and efficient disposal. This flexibility makes incineration an ideal solution for industries that produce complex or potentially harmful waste products that require specialized treatment.
Despite its many advantages, it is important to note that incinerator systems are not without their challenges. Critics argue that incineration can still release harmful pollutants such as dioxins and heavy metals into the atmosphere, albeit at lower levels compared to older incineration technologies. Proper monitoring and regulation are essential to ensure that incinerators operate within strict environmental standards and do not pose a risk to public health or the environment.
